To make endnotes appear in your published content, you need to create a topic at the end of your book in which your references appear on publication. To maintain consistency across all your topics, create an endnote template topic.

Author-it best practice also suggests that you create a reference topic and add it to a common use folder for your authors to reuse, or add it to a book template so it automatically appears as a topic in the book.

To create an endnote topic template:

  1. Create a new topic based on (none).
  2. Select the Make this object an object template check box.
  3. On the Print tab, select the Make this an endnote topic check box.
  4. Select the appropriate numbering option for your endnotes.
  5. Click OK or Apply to save.
